Hereditary spastic paraplegia (HSP) presents as a group of neurological disorders that primarily affect the lower limbs. While there is currently no definitive solution for HSP, a variety of treatment options are available to alleviate its symptoms and improve quality of life.
Treatment options encompass a variety of therapies, including physical therapy, occupational therapy, and assistive devices. Physical therapy can assist in strengthening muscles, improving flexibility, and improving mobility. Occupational therapy focuses on adapting daily tasks to make them more manageable.
- Tools like canes, walkers, and wheelchairs can provide mobility aid
- Pharmaceutical interventions may be employed for specific symptoms, including muscle spasms or pain
- In some cases of HSP, surgery may be an option to relieve pressure on the spinal cord
It's essential for individuals with HSP to collaborate with a team of healthcare professionals to create a personalized treatment plan that addresses their individual needs and goals.
Strengthening Your Journey: Exercises for Hereditary Spastic Paraplegia
Living with hereditary spastic paraplegia Hereditary Spastic Paraparesis (HSP) can present unique challenges. Though, it's essential to remember that regular exercise plays a vital role in managing symptoms and improving quality of life.
A tailored exercise program can help strengthen your muscles, increase flexibility, and enhance your overall fitness. It is important to discuss with your doctor or physical therapist to create a personalized plan that suits your individual needs and abilities.
Here are some general exercise recommendations for individuals living with HSP:
* **Range of Motion Exercises:** These exercises help maintain flexibility in your joints and prevent stiffness. Gentle stretches focusing on your legs, arms, and torso can be beneficial.
* **Strengthening Exercises:** Focus on strengthening the muscles in your legs, core, and upper body. Use light weights or resistance bands to challenge these muscle groups.
* **Cardiovascular Exercise:** Engaging in moderate-intensity cardiovascular exercise such as walking, swimming, or cycling can improve your heart health and strength.
* **Balance Exercises:** Incorporating balance exercises into your routine can help minimize the risk of falls. Try check here standing on one leg for short periods or using a stability ball to challenge your balance.
Remember to start slowly and gradually intensify the intensity and duration of your workouts as you feel comfortable. Be mindful to your body and take breaks when needed.

Boosting Mobility: Physical Therapy Strategies for HSP
Hereditary Spastic Paraplegia (HSP) frequently presents with progressive stiffness and weakness in the legs, making mobility a significant challenge. Physical therapy plays a crucial role in managing these symptoms and boosting daily function. A comprehensive physical therapy program may encompass targeted exercises to build leg muscles, increase flexibility, and promote balance and coordination. In addition to individualized exercise routines, therapists often utilize modalities like heat therapy, massage, and electrical stimulation to alleviate muscle spasticity and pain. Regular physical therapy can help individuals with HSP maintain their independence, enhance quality of life, and navigate daily activities more successfully.
- Moreover, assistive devices such as braces or walkers may be recommended to provide support and stability.
- Seek advice from a qualified physical therapist specializing in neurologic conditions for a personalized treatment plan.
